Mountfield HK beat Liberec 6-4 in a pre-season thriller at ČPP Aréna, with Robert Kousal scoring twice and Dávid Mudrák adding an empty-netter to seal a 4-0 pre-season start.

How it unfolded

Mountfield struck inside two minutes when Robert Kousal — the 35-year-old forward making his early mark since joining Hradec — converted from close range after a feed from Aleš Jergl (2'). But Liberec responded swiftly. Martin Faško-Rudáš equalised at 6' (assisted by Tomáš Filippi and Tomáš Galvas), and Jakub Rychlovský tipped home at 10' to put the visitors 2-1 up.

A power-play goal from Alex Tamáši — deflecting Lukáš Radil's shot-pass at 19' — levelled at 2-2 after the first period, a fair reflection of an open frame.

The second period followed the same pattern. Servác Petrovský restored Liberec's lead with a man-advantage goal at 29' (assists from Adam Musil and Tomáš Galvas). But Mountfield flipped the game inside 98 seconds: Lukáš Radil pounced on a loose puck after Patrik Miškář's blocked shot to make it 3-3 at 38', and Robert Kousal raced clear on a breakaway at 39' to complete his brace and give the hosts a 4-3 lead heading into the final period.

Jakub Rychlovský beat Tomáš Vomáčka with a backhand deke at 43' for his second of the night, restoring parity at 4-4. The game seemed destined for overtime when Mountfield produced a decisive late surge. Dominik Pavlík swept home from close range at 58' after a defensive-zone turnover by Liberec, and Dávid Mudrák iced the win with an empty-net goal from inside his own zone at 59' after the visitors pulled goaltender Petr Kváča for an extra skater.

The turning point

Liberec's failed clearance behind their own net with under three minutes to go proved decisive. The turnover gifted the puck to Markus Nenonen, whose pass set up Dominik Pavlík to fire into an unguarded net. Mountfield went from 4-4 to 6-4 in 74 seconds — the kind of ruthlessness pre-season is designed to instil.

Key performers

  • Robert Kousal (Mountfield HK) — two goals (2', 39'), including a breakaway to put his side ahead late in the second period. The veteran forward, a new arrival this summer, already looks integrated. 🟢 Player of the match.
  • Jakub Rychlovský (Liberec) — a brace of his own (10', 43'), the second a neatly executed breakaway backhand. The Liberec-born forward, who returned to the club this off-season, showed the finishing touch that made him the top scorer in the U20 league last season.
  • Tomáš Vomáčka (Mountfield HK) — made several sharp saves, particularly in the second period when Liberec held sustained pressure after Petrovský's goal, and again late in the third with the score tied.
  • Lukáš Radil (Mountfield HK) — a goal and an assist, including the pass that set up Tamáši's power-play equaliser in the first.

By the numbers — interpreted

Both sides finished with one power-play goal from limited opportunities (Mountfield 1/4, Liberec 1/2). The penalty differential (2 against Mountfield, 4 against Liberec) suggests discipline favoured the home side, though neither team's special teams dominated. The six-goal tally continues a long-running trend: 94% of the 50 all-time meetings between these clubs have gone over 2.5 goals, and the average of 5.22 goals per match held up emphatically here. Pre-season caveats apply — both sides rotated liberally, with Mountfield icing four forward lines and seven defencemen — but the attacking intent was unmistakable from both benches.

What it means

Mountfield HK complete the first block of their pre-season with a 4-0-0 record, having beaten Jihlava (3-0), Olomouc (3-2), EC Red Bull Salzburg (2-1 SO) and now Liberec. Their next friendly is at home against Graz 99ers on Friday 21 August (17:00 CET).

Liberec's pre-season form reads 2-1-1 after wins over Mladá Boleslav (3-1 and 6-0), a shutout loss to Kladno (0-1) and this defeat. They host Graz 99ers on Monday 25 August.

Verdict

A thoroughly entertaining pre-season friendly that delivered everything except defence. Both teams have attacking chemistry to be encouraged by and structural work still to do before the Extraliga campaign begins. Kousal's two-goal showing was the headline, but the resilience Mountfield showed — equalising three times before taking the lead — will please head coach Tomáš Martinec most.

Rivalry since 2018

Mountfield HK vs Liberec Head to Head Results· 50

Mountfield HK and Liberec have met 50 times — Mountfield HK won 22, Liberec won 28, with 0 draws. Their rivalry dates back to 2018. Liberec leads the head-to-head with 28 victories from 50 meetings. A combined 261 goals have been scored across these fixtures, averaging 5.22 per match (120 for the home side, 141 for the visitors). Both teams scored in 43 matches (86%). Over 2.5 goals landed in 47 games (94%), making it a fixture that tends to produce goals. The highest-scoring encounter finished 6–4 in 2023.
